Output 23059169eaddbdd63a2f6bb537df093e7ffc2ca2fc9de3084f0879def45b4dc9:0

value
109994525
script pubkey
OP_0 OP_PUSHBYTES_20 127d905397f27a2215c4156e6161ac62c96a0707
address
bc1qzf7eq5uh7fazy9wyz4hxzcdvvtyk5pc8f40rk7
transaction
23059169eaddbdd63a2f6bb537df093e7ffc2ca2fc9de3084f0879def45b4dc9
confirmations
160840
spent
true